Generals Finish 2nd at Passing Tourney
Dinwiddie County Football team finished 2nd at the Western Branch Invitationional 7-on-7 tournament this past Saturday, to reigning D-6 champion Oscar Smith. Dinwiddie’s record on the day was 5 and 1, with their only loss coming in the championship game.
Dinwiddie made it to the championship game by defeating 2008 D-6 playoff teams Grassfield and Ocean Lakes.

Dinwiddie WR Featured On ESPNU
Senior wide receiver Quintaze Jackson (5′11″ 170 lb senior WR) was featured on ESPNU with video and evaluation check it out at:
Last year Quintaze had 51 receptions for 827 yards (16.2 per catch) and 8 touchdowns, and 11 rushes for 134 yards and 1 touchdown, 88 yards in kickoff returns, 1045 all purpose yardage.
He was named 1st Team All District WR, 2nd Team All Region WR, 2nd Team All Metro WR, and 1st Team All Progress Index WR. This will be Quintaze’s third year as a starter.

Athletic Physicals - July 22
Dinwiddie County High School will be offering athletic physicals for a fee of $10.00 to any currently enrolled student on July 22, 2009 at 1:00 pm. Doors will not open until 1:00 PM.
Students must have a parent present and a NEW VHSL physical form, signed by a parent with complete insurance information, and $10.00 to receive a physical.
This will be the only opportunity to get a VHSL athletic physical from Dinwiddie High School for the 2009-2010 school year.
